Barbara_Saunders (25113 bytes)Barbara Saunders with John L. Scott Real Estate in Port Townsend has successfully completed the educational requirements for the designation of Certified International Property Specialist (CIPS) awarded by the National Association of Realtors® (NAR).

Having received her training in Thailand and France, the program of study focuses on critical aspects of international real estate, including currency and exchange rates, cross-cultural relationships, regional market conditions and tax issues. The designation is awarded when candidates who have completed the educational requirements also complete a set of practical requirements. There are currently nine (9) Realtors® in Washington State who have earned the CIPS designation. There are approximately 2,000 real estate practitioners worldwide that hold the CIPS designation.

In addition to the CIPS designation, Barbara has trained, tested, and received Transnational Referral Certification (TRC). This certification is awarded by the International Consortium of Real Estate Associations, an affiliate association of the National Association of Realtors® that provides training and services to facilitate international transactions. Barbara Saunders is among 12 Realtors® in Washington that have received this certification.
